Sobhita Dhulipala Biography: A Tale of Talent and Triumph
Sobhita Dhulipala, the enchanting star of Indian cinema, has gracefully etched her name in the hearts of audiences across Hindi, Malayalam, Tamil, and Telugu films. Born on May 31, 1992, in Tenali, Andhra Pradesh, Sobhita emerged from the vibrant tapestry of a Telugu Brahmin family. Her journey from the shores of Visakhapatnam to the glitzy streets of Mumbai reflects not just a career but a captivating saga of determination, talent, and success.
Early Years and Artistic Roots
Sobhita Dhulipala’s story begins with her roots in Tenali, where she blossomed under the care of her father, Venugopal Rao, a Merchant Navy engineer, and her mother, Santha Kamakshi, a devoted primary school teacher. The call of the arts echoed early in her life, leading her to become a skilled practitioner of both Bharatanatyam and Kuchipudi. The move to Mumbai at the age of sixteen marked the commencement of her solo sojourn, driven by the passion for the cinematic world.
A Rising Star: Navy Queen and College Days
The year 2010 saw Sobhita crowned as the Navy Queen at the annual Navy Ball, foreshadowing her ascent in the world of glamour. Her academic pursuits led her to the H.R. College of Commerce and Economics in Mumbai, where she continued to hone her skills, both academically and artistically.

Beyond the Silver Screen
Sobhita Dhulipala’s cinematic journey began with Anurag Kashyap’s “Raman Raghav 2.0” in 2016, leading to a three-film deal with Phantom Films. Her talent traversed boundaries, finding expression in Telugu, Malayalam, and Hindi films. Notable among her works is the Amazon Prime series “Made In Heaven,” where she portrayed the meticulous wedding planner Tara, marking a transition into the digital space.
Recognition and Accolades
Sobhita’s talent has not gone unnoticed, earning her nominations at prestigious awards such as the Screen Awards and iReel Awards. The Indian Television Academy Awards bestowed upon her the title of Best Actress — Popular (OTT) for “The Night Manager.”
